Detailed description:
 
 

  

Overview:
    The hollow shaft is packed with wedge-shaped hollow blades, and the heat medium flows through the hollow shaft through the blade. Unit effective volume within the heat transfer area is very large, heat medium temperature from -40 ℃ to 320 ℃, can be water vapor, it can be liquid type: such as hot water, heat transfer oil. Indirect conduction heating, no air to take away the heat, heat are used to heat the material. Heat loss is only through the body insulation layer to the environment heat. Wedge-type paddle heat transfer surface with self-cleaning function. The relative movement of the material particles and the wedge surface produces a scrubbing effect, which can wash away the material attached to the wedge surface so that the clean heat transfer surface is maintained during operation. The blades of the paddle drier are of the W type, and two to four hollow agitators are generally arranged in the housing. The shell has a sealed end cap and an upper cover to prevent material leakage and the collection of material solvent vapor. The mouth of the mouth set up a block to ensure that the material level, so that the heat transfer surface is covered by materials and play a full role. The heat medium is driven by a rotary joint through a shell jacket and a hollow stirring shaft. The hollow stirring shaft has a different internal structure depending on the type of heat medium to ensure optimum heat transfer.





 

application:
    The blade dryer has been successfully used in food, chemical, petrochemical, dyes, industrial sludge and other fields. The equipment heats up, cools, and agitates the following unit operations: calcination (low temperature), cooling, drying (solvent recovery), heating (melting), reaction and sterilization. Stirring blade is also a heat transfer surface, so that the unit effective volume within the heat transfer area increases, shortening the processing time. Wedge-type blade heat transfer surface and has a self-cleaning function. The compression-swell function makes the material mix evenly. Material along the axial into the "piston flow" movement, in the axial section, the material temperature, humidity, mixing gradient is very small.
● With heat transfer oil to do heat medium, paddle dryer can be completed low temperature calcination work. Such as calcium sulfate dihydrate (Ca2SO4 · 2H2O) calcined into calcium sulfate hemihydrate (Ca2SO4.1 / 2H2O). Sodium bicarbonate (NaHCO3) is calcined to soda ash (Na2CO3) and so on.
● Access to cooling medium, such as water, cooling brine, etc. can be used to cool. Such as: used in the soda ash industry paddle-type cooler machine, replacing the old air-cooled cooler machine, saving energy and exhaust treatment equipment, reducing operating costs, can also be used for titanium dioxide, nickel-iron alloy powder and various powder Material cooling. The material can be cooled from 1000 ° C to less than 40 ° C in a single machine.
● Dry, the main function of the equipment, do not use hot air, so that solvent recovery, energy consumption, environmental control in the ideal state of easy handling. It is particularly suitable for solvent, flammable and easy to oxidize heat-sensitive materials. Has been widely used in fine chemical, petrochemical, dyestuff industry.
● In the axial section, the temperature, humidity, uniformity of the mixing, so that equipment can be used to heat or melt, or carry out some solid material reaction. In the compound fertilizer and modified starch industry have been successfully used. The paddle dryer can be used to sterilize food and flour. The unit effective volume of large heating area, and soon the material will be heated to sterilization temperature, to avoid prolonged heating and change the material quality.
Adapt to material
Petrochemical industry: polyolefin powder, polycarbonate resin, high and low density polyethylene, linear low density polyethylene, polyacetal particles, nylon 6, nylon 66, nylon 12, acetate fiber, polyphenylene sulfide, Based resin, engineering plastics, polyvinyl chloride, polyvinyl alcohol, polystyrene, polypropylene, polyester, polyoxymethylene, styrene ~ acrylonitrile copolymer, ethylene ~ propylene copolymerization.
Environmental protection industry: PTA sludge, electroplating sewage sludge, boiler soot, pharmaceutical waste, sugar residue, monosodium glutamate plant waste, coal ash.
Feed industry: soy sauce residue, bone feed, lees, food under the material, apple pomace, orange peel, soybean meal, chicken bone feed, fish meal, feed additives, biological slag
Food industry: starch, cocoa beans, corn kernels, salt, modified starch, drugs.
Chemical industry: soda ash, nitrogen, phosphorus and potassium compound fertilizer, kaolin, bentonite, white carbon black, carbon black, phosphogypsum, sodium fluoride, calcium nitrate, magnesium carbonate, sodium cyanide, aluminum hydroxide, barium sulfate, Calcium carbonate, dyes, molecular sieves, saponin.
Features:
● blade dryer low energy consumption: due to indirect heating, there is no large amount of air to take away the heat, the dryer wall and set the insulation layer, the slurry material, evaporation of 1kg water only 1.22kg water vapor.
● Blade dryer system low cost: the unit effective volume has a huge heat transfer surface, to shorten the processing time, equipment size smaller. It greatly reduces the construction area and building space.
● Wide range of materials used: the use of different heat medium, can handle heat-sensitive materials, but also deal with the need for high-temperature treatment of materials. Commonly used media are: water vapor, heat transfer oil, hot water, cooling water and so on. Can be continuous operation can also be intermittent operation, can be applied in many areas.
● environmental pollution: do not use to carry air, dust material entrainment rarely. Material solvent evaporation is very small, easy to handle. For the pollution of the material or the need to recover the solvent conditions, can be used closed circuit.
● low operating costs: the normal operation of the device, only 1-2 people / day. Low-speed mixing and reasonable structure. Wear a small amount of maintenance costs are very low.
● Stable operation: Due to the special compression-expansion stirring effect of wedge blades, the material particles are fully in contact with the heat transfer surface. In the axial section, the temperature, humidity and mixing degree of the material are very small, The stability of the.
